Question

The floor of a cuboidal hall has perimeter equal to 250 m and height 6 m. Find the cost of painting its four walls (including doors etc) at the rate of Rs.8 per square metre.

Given that, the perimeter of floor of a rectangular hall is 250 m.
Also, the height of walls, h=6 m.
To find out: Cost of painting the four walls (including doors) at the rate of Rs. 8 per m2.

Two walls of the hall will have dimensions l×h and the rest two will have b×h.
Hence, the total area of four walls =2(l×h)+2(b×h)=2h(l+b).
Given that the perimeter is 250 m.
2(l+b)=250.
Hence, area of four walls =h×2(l+b)=6×250=1500 m2

Now, cost of painting 1 m2 area is Rs. 8.
Cost of painting 1500 m2=8×1500=Rs. 12000.

Hence, the cost of painting the four walls of the hall is Rs. 12000.
